Race: Slate Canyon 5k (3.1 Miles) 00:21:09, Place overall: 3, Place in age division: 2
Easy MilesMarathon Pace MilesThreshold MilesVO2 Max MilesCrosstraining milesTotal Miles
7.500.000.003.100.0010.60

I wanted a pr in the 5k today but after seeing the course I knew that would be though.  There is a lot of up hill in it.  So I just ran hard enough to make my throat burn and keep Maryanne in sight.  The course starts with a very short downhill and then about 1.25 of a really good climb, then another short down hill and then more uphill for some and then rolling.  Ending with about some down and then a good climb to the finish.  Whew it wiped me out.

splits

1-6:37

2-6:49

3-6:48

.15-00:55

Warmed up 3 miles and cooled down 4.4
